PERI-IMPLANTITIS: NON-SURGICAL TREATMENT

Introduction: The aim of this article is to present and summarize the non-surgical treatment options in management of peri-implant diseases and compare the effectiveness of the treatment with/without adjunctive use of antibiotics.

Methods: A search was conducted in the PubMed- MEDLINE, Scopus, Embase, and Google Scholar databases, and available repositories, followed by a hand search. The relevant clinical studies, reviews, and consensuses about the non-surgical peri-implant therapy published between 1990–2022 in English language were included.

Conclusion: Based on the available information, it can be said that there is a great diversity in the treatment of dental implants affected by peri-implantitis. Studies testing different therapeutic protocols are rare and highly heterogeneous. Stabilization of peri-implant disease after the treatment without systemic or local antibiotics is possible, but the reduction of probing depth around the dental implant using only the non-surgical therapy is still insufficient. Non-surgical treatment is therefore successful particularly in solving the peri-implant mucositis and also as a conditioning before surgical therapy.
